A Potential Elite Duo with Maxx Crosby

One of the most exciting aspects of this potential move is the partnership between Josh Sweat and Maxx Crosby. Crosby, one of the league’s most relentless and disruptive pass rushers, has been the heart and soul of the Raiders' defense. Adding Sweat to the mix would create a formidable pass-rushing tandem that could wreak havoc in the AFC West.

With Crosby’s high motor and physicality combined with Sweat’s explosiveness and technique, the Raiders would have one of the best edge-rushing duos in the NFL. This would be a nightmare for quarterbacks, especially in a division that features elite passers like Patrick Mahomes and Justin Herbert.

Why the Raiders Make Sense for Sweat

There are several reasons why Las Vegas would be an appealing destination for Josh Sweat:

  • Opportunity to be a featured pass rusher: While he has thrived in Philadelphia, Sweat has often been part of a deep defensive line rotation. In Las Vegas, he would have the chance to play a more significant role.
  • The need for another elite edge rusher: The Raiders have long relied on Maxx Crosby, but adding Sweat would bring much-needed balance and take pressure off their star defender.
  • Competing in a tough division: The AFC West is loaded with offensive firepower, and the Raiders will need a dominant defense to stay competitive. Sweat could be a major piece in solidifying their defensive front.

Will the Eagles Let Him Walk?

While speculation continues, Philadelphia may not be ready to part ways with Sweat so easily. The Eagles have built their defense around a strong pass rush, and losing him would create a significant hole. However, with **salasalary cap constraints and other key players needing new deals, Philadelphia may be forced to make a tough decision.

If the Eagles opt not to extend Sweat, the Raiders appear to be in prime position to land him. His skill set aligns perfectly with their defensive needs, and the potential partnership with Maxx Crosby could make Las Vegas a legitimate force on defense.
